changes/bug7708

@@ -0,0 +1,5 @@
+  o Major bugfixes:
+    - When a TLS write is partially successful but incomplete, remember
+      that the flushed part has been flushed, and notice that bytes were
+      actually written. Reported and fixed pseudonymously. Fixes bug
+      7708; bugfix on Tor 0.1.0.5-rc.
